当前位置: 首页 > news >正文

怎么用手机网站做软件好长春网站优化指导

怎么用手机网站做软件好,长春网站优化指导,wordpress 隐藏后台更新,网络架构和现实架构的差异一、UniApp 简介 UniApp 是中国DCloud公司研发的一款创新的跨平台应用开发框架,它基于广受欢迎的前端开发库Vue.js,旨在解决多端适配和快速开发的问题。通过UniApp,开发者能够采用一套统一的代码结构、语法和API来构建应用程序,从而实现真正意义上的“一次编写,到处运行”…

一、UniApp 简介

UniApp 是中国DCloud公司研发的一款创新的跨平台应用开发框架,它基于广受欢迎的前端开发库Vue.js,旨在解决多端适配和快速开发的问题。通过UniApp,开发者能够采用一套统一的代码结构、语法和API来构建应用程序,从而实现真正意义上的“一次编写,到处运行”(Write Once, Run Anywhere,简称WORA),大幅降低了跨多个终端平台进行应用开发的成本与复杂度。

该框架不仅支持原生iOS与Android移动应用的打包发布,还兼容Web浏览器环境下的H5应用开发,并无缝对接各大主流小程序平台,如微信小程序、支付宝小程序、百度智能小程序、字节跳动小程序(今日头条、抖音)、QQ小程序以及快手小程序等。这意味着开发者可以使用同一套代码库,针对不同应用场景轻松输出适应各平台特性的高质量产品。

UniApp的设计理念强调高效和易用性,其内置了丰富的UI组件库uni-ui,提供了一套完整的解决方案,包括但不限于视图容器、表单控件、反馈提示、导航菜单、多媒体组件以及各种实用工具类组件。此外,它还集成了强大的API接口,涵盖了网络请求、设备访问、数据存储、地理位置服务等多个方面,确保开发者在享受跨平台便利的同时,也能充分利用各个平台的特性功能。

综上所述,UniApp已成为众多开发者在跨端应用开发领域中首选的利器,助力他们快速响应市场需求,打造出高性能、高用户体验的全栈式跨平台应用。

二、环境配置与项目创建

1. 安装HBuilderX:

  • 下载安装:首先,访问DCloud官网(https://www.dcloud.io/)下载最新版的HBuilderX开发工具。HBuilderX是专为跨平台应用开发设计的集成开发环境(IDE),尤其是针对UniApp框架进行了深度优化。下载完成后按照安装向导进行安装操作。

  • 熟悉基本操作:启动HBuilderX后,开发者将接触到其简洁直观的界面和功能布局,包括文件管理、代码编辑器、调试工具、模拟器等模块。通过菜单栏、工具栏以及快捷键可以快速进行新建文件、保存、查找替换、格式化代码等基础操作。此外,HBuilderX还集成了实时预览、智能提示、自动补全等功能,有助于提高开发效率。

2. 创建UniApp项目:

  • 新建项目:在HBuilderX主界面上方点击“文件”菜单,选择“新建”,然后选择“项目”。在弹出的新建项目窗口中,找到“UniApp”分类并选择合适的模板,例如“uni-app项目”或“uni-app插件项目”。

  • 设置项目信息:填写项目名称,这是您即将创建的应用程序的标识符,应具有一定的意义以便于识别。接着指定项目的保存路径,确保所选目录有足够的空间存储项目文件,并易于后期管理和维护。

  • 初始化项目:根据需要选择项目的基础配置,如是否包含Hello World示例代码、是否使用Vue.js 3版本等。完成所有选项设定后,点击“确定”按钮,HBuilderX会自动生成一个基于UniApp标准结构的项目文件夹,其中包括配置文件、源码目录、资源目录等。

3. 配置运行环境:

  • 模拟器配置与使用:在HBuilderX中内置了多个平台的模拟器,允许开发者无需真机即可直接预览和调试应用效果。打开项目后,在左侧项目资源管理器中找到相应页面文件,右键选择“运行到手机模拟器”或“运行到浏览器模拟器”,可以选择iOS、Android或其他小程序平台的模拟器来查看应用界面。

  • 真机调试:对于物理设备上的测试,HBuilderX也提供了便捷的真机调试支持。开发者需先确保设备已连接至电脑,并开启USB调试模式(对于Android设备)或信任此电脑(对于iOS设备)。在HBuilderX中选择相应的真机运行选项,系统将自动打包并将应用部署至设备上运行。此时,开发者可在真实环境中实时查看和修改代码后的效果,并利用IDE中的调试工具进行断点调试、日志查看等操作。

综上所述,从安装HBuilderX开始,经过创建UniApp项目以及配置运行环境这三个关键步骤,开发者能够快速搭建起一套完整的UniApp开发环境,并在不同平台上进行高效且便捷的应用开发及调试工作。在整个过程中,HBuilderX强大的集成特性极大地简化了多端适配的复杂性,使开发者能够集中精力于业务逻辑与用户体验的提升。

三、UniApp基础语法与组件使用

1. Vue.js基础
Vue.js是构建用户界面的渐进式框架,UniApp正是基于此框架开发的一套可以编译到多个平台的应用解决方案。在 UniApp 中,开发者需要掌握以下Vue的基础概念和语法:

  • 数据绑定:Vue通过MVVM(Model-View-ViewModel)模式实现了双向数据绑定。在模板中使用{{ }}包裹变量名实现文本插值,如 <span>{{ message }}</span>,其中 message 是Vue实例中的响应式数据属性。

  • 指令:Vue通过指令来扩展HTML元素的功能。例如v-bind用于动态绑定属性值,简写为:v-ifv-show控制元素显示或隐藏;v-for进行列表渲染;v-model用于表单元素的双向数据绑定等。

  • 计算属性:在Vue实例中,可通过computed属性定义一些依赖于其他数据并会实时更新的复杂表达式。例如:

    computed: {

文章转载自:
http://anaculture.rpwm.cn
http://doubledome.rpwm.cn
http://tarnishproof.rpwm.cn
http://newbuilding.rpwm.cn
http://taileron.rpwm.cn
http://underclothe.rpwm.cn
http://recallable.rpwm.cn
http://matin.rpwm.cn
http://whoosy.rpwm.cn
http://hydrogenation.rpwm.cn
http://undope.rpwm.cn
http://inheritor.rpwm.cn
http://inquest.rpwm.cn
http://chengdu.rpwm.cn
http://transact.rpwm.cn
http://elevon.rpwm.cn
http://lorrie.rpwm.cn
http://nutate.rpwm.cn
http://imputable.rpwm.cn
http://fernico.rpwm.cn
http://brainfag.rpwm.cn
http://chair.rpwm.cn
http://endoparasite.rpwm.cn
http://paramagnetism.rpwm.cn
http://reverberate.rpwm.cn
http://shortcut.rpwm.cn
http://participial.rpwm.cn
http://spirophore.rpwm.cn
http://dimensional.rpwm.cn
http://alsorunner.rpwm.cn
http://bioaccumulation.rpwm.cn
http://number.rpwm.cn
http://rpq.rpwm.cn
http://unbroken.rpwm.cn
http://tensometer.rpwm.cn
http://phenformin.rpwm.cn
http://freon.rpwm.cn
http://feeze.rpwm.cn
http://gyppy.rpwm.cn
http://hydroid.rpwm.cn
http://keten.rpwm.cn
http://acetone.rpwm.cn
http://olfaction.rpwm.cn
http://saxatile.rpwm.cn
http://basecoat.rpwm.cn
http://amianthus.rpwm.cn
http://secondary.rpwm.cn
http://squoosh.rpwm.cn
http://racialism.rpwm.cn
http://cambria.rpwm.cn
http://submundane.rpwm.cn
http://hornpout.rpwm.cn
http://aerodyne.rpwm.cn
http://used.rpwm.cn
http://ascetical.rpwm.cn
http://bullate.rpwm.cn
http://cantabrian.rpwm.cn
http://duettist.rpwm.cn
http://spectrophosphorimeter.rpwm.cn
http://spongiform.rpwm.cn
http://recollectedly.rpwm.cn
http://reedify.rpwm.cn
http://desi.rpwm.cn
http://graphitoidal.rpwm.cn
http://pedobaptist.rpwm.cn
http://terrace.rpwm.cn
http://ileal.rpwm.cn
http://snaggletoothed.rpwm.cn
http://impetuously.rpwm.cn
http://cyprinid.rpwm.cn
http://amgot.rpwm.cn
http://been.rpwm.cn
http://wrongdoing.rpwm.cn
http://ripper.rpwm.cn
http://exaltation.rpwm.cn
http://incomparable.rpwm.cn
http://sunward.rpwm.cn
http://apartness.rpwm.cn
http://bevatron.rpwm.cn
http://discovrery.rpwm.cn
http://dowthcory.rpwm.cn
http://leglet.rpwm.cn
http://franco.rpwm.cn
http://dispenses.rpwm.cn
http://maracay.rpwm.cn
http://shrike.rpwm.cn
http://clamlike.rpwm.cn
http://revile.rpwm.cn
http://procrypsis.rpwm.cn
http://seepage.rpwm.cn
http://aestivation.rpwm.cn
http://ius.rpwm.cn
http://nucleon.rpwm.cn
http://spermatogonium.rpwm.cn
http://nocent.rpwm.cn
http://moist.rpwm.cn
http://echolalia.rpwm.cn
http://pyromagnetic.rpwm.cn
http://buccolingual.rpwm.cn
http://leicestershire.rpwm.cn
http://www.15wanjia.com/news/74014.html

相关文章:

  • 有没有专门做标书的网站关键词优化的策略
  • 游戏ui设计是什么微博seo营销
  • seo网站排名推广新闻软文范例大全
  • 石家庄桥西网站制作公司天津网络推广seo
  • 帮忙做ppt的网站seo教学
  • 安徽省住房建设厅网站青岛网站seo
  • 小门户网站开发一键优化是什么意思
  • 大气金融网站seo平台是什么
  • 为什么找不到做网站的软件北京百度网站排名优化
  • 网站建设策划书 备案肇庆百度快速排名
  • 加油站建设专业网站旺道营销软件
  • wordpress mkv格式网站seo优化方案设计
  • 织梦制作html 网站地图yahoo搜索
  • 网站在线统计代码semen是什么意思
  • 网站升级 云南省建设注册考试中心seo优化员
  • 建筑工程造价网四川seo
  • 在哪个网站有兼职做新闻头条
  • 网站开发协议书目前引流最好的app
  • 武汉品牌网站建设公司江苏营销型网站建设
  • web建立虚拟网站十大销售管理软件排行榜
  • qq代挂网站建设百度竞价推广怎么做
  • 网站标题seo百度用户服务中心官网电话
  • 网站开发知识付费微博指数查询入口
  • 个旧做网站哪家公司好搜索词排行榜
  • 浙江嘉兴建设局网站长沙seo培训
  • 小工程承包网app整站优化是什么意思
  • 备案 个人网站名称seo教程搜索引擎优化
  • 河北网站建设报价上海优化网站
  • 海东营销网站建设关于软文营销的案例
  • 马鞍山网站建设公seo平台优化服务